
In today’s digital landscape, where vast amounts of sensitive data traverse global networks, encryption has become a cornerstone of data protection. From personal information to corporate secrets, encryption shields data from prying eyes, ensuring privacy, security, and compliance with regulations. In this blog, we’ll demystify encryption, its role in securing data, and best practices for implementation.
1. What is Encryption?
At its core, encryption is a method of converting data into an unreadable format using algorithms and keys. Only authorized parties with the correct decryption key can decode the information. This ensures that even if the data is intercepted, it remains unintelligible.
Two key types of encryption:
Symmetric Encryption: The same key is used for both encryption and decryption. While fast, it requires secure key management.
Asymmetric Encryption: Uses a pair of keys—public and private. The public key encrypts the data, and the private key decrypts it. This method is more secure but slower.
2. Importance of Encryption in Data Protection
Confidentiality: Ensures that sensitive data remains private and cannot be accessed by unauthorized parties.
Integrity: Prevents unauthorized modification of data by alerting users to tampering attempts.
Authentication: Verifies the identity of individuals or systems, ensuring trustworthiness.
Regulatory Compliance: Encryption is often required to meet data protection standards like GDPR, CCPA, and HIPAA.
3. Applications of Encryption in Everyday Life
Encryption is woven into various aspects of our daily digital interactions:
Messaging Apps: Platforms like WhatsApp and Signal use end-to-end encryption to secure communications.
Online Shopping: Encryption secures financial transactions, safeguarding credit card and banking details.
Cloud Storage: Protects sensitive files stored in cloud platforms like Google Drive or Dropbox.
Healthcare Systems: Safeguards patient records, ensuring compliance with data privacy laws.
4. How Does Encryption Work?
Encryption is a multi-step process involving:
Plaintext: The original readable data.
Algorithm: The mathematical function that scrambles the data.
Encryption Key: A unique string used by the algorithm to encode the data.
Ciphertext: The scrambled, unreadable data.
The reverse process, decryption, uses a decryption key to transform ciphertext back into plaintext.
5. Common Encryption Algorithms
AES (Advanced Encryption Standard): A widely used symmetric algorithm known for its speed and efficiency.
RSA: An asymmetric algorithm ideal for secure data transmission.
Blowfish: A fast, symmetric encryption method often used in financial transactions.
Elliptic Curve Cryptography (ECC): Provides high security with shorter key lengths, making it ideal for mobile devices.
6. Encryption in the Era of Cyber Threats
As cyber threats grow in complexity, encryption acts as a frontline defense against:
Data Breaches: Encrypting data renders it useless to hackers, even if stolen.
Man-in-the-Middle (MITM) Attacks: Secures communications, preventing interception.
Ransomware Attacks: Encryption tools can secure backups, mitigating the impact of ransomware.
7. Challenges of Encryption
While encryption is powerful, it’s not without challenges:
Key Management: Mismanaging encryption keys can lead to data loss.
Performance Impact: Strong encryption algorithms may slow down processes.
Compliance Complexity: Ensuring encryption complies with global regulations can be daunting.
8. Best Practices for Encryption
Choose Robust Algorithms: Opt for proven, industry-standard encryption methods like AES or RSA.
Use Strong Keys: Longer keys are harder to crack.
Implement End-to-End Encryption: Ensure data is encrypted from its source to its destination.
Regularly Update Protocols: Stay ahead of vulnerabilities by using the latest encryption standards.
Train Employees: Ensure staff understand encryption’s importance and their role in maintaining data security.
9. The Future of Encryption
As technology evolves, so does encryption:
Post-Quantum Cryptography: Preparing for the advent of quantum computers that could potentially break existing algorithms.
Homomorphic Encryption: Allows data to be processed without being decrypted, enhancing security for cloud computing and AI applications.
Conclusion
Encryption is a critical shield in the fight against cyber threats. By understanding its principles, applications, and best practices, businesses and individuals can protect their data from unauthorized access and maintain trust in a digital world.
We use cookies that are necessary for the smooth operation of the website, to improve our website and to display advertising relevant to you on social media platforms and partner websites.By clicking "Accept all", you agree to the use of cookies for convenience features and statistics and tracking.You can change these settings again at any time.If you do not agree, we will limit ourselves to technically necessary cookies. For more information, please see our privacy policy.